I have only just purchased the Gone Fishing Bundle and I really love this set as I don't make a lot of masculine cards and this was a hit with my card class attendees.

I have cased the tackle box which is featured on page 78 which has the Let's Go Fishing Suite Collection which also includes a pack of Designer Series Paper and Twisted Rope 3D Embossing Folder.

I used one of the new colours Pecan Pie for the tackle Box.  I made sure I placed the large rectangle die over the left hand side centre fold of the card so it made a corner on each four corners.  

I then cut out the sections of the tackle box in Pecan Pie and raised it up using very thin strips of the ? dimensionals, once positioned I stamped the textured background and sentiment agin in Pecan Pie.  

It was then time to stamp all the sinkers, floats and flys and then used Basic Grey cardstock for the weights and hooks with the dies.

I have chosen a card on page 160 of the Annual Catalogue.  I created this card last Sunday in preparation for a new born which I did not now the sex at the time but I was hoping it was a girl so I chose a more of a neutral colour of Lemon Lime Twist.

I have torn pieces of Lemon Lime Twist cardstock and Glorious Gingham Designer Series Paper and layered this onto my cardstock base some with Multipurpose glue and some with dimensional to given some added depth and texture.  


Just a tip when you are tearing the Designer Series Paper you can either have a white edge or not depending upon which way you start tearing (either right to left or left to right), I have used both on the first strip.

I then fussy cut the cut crocodile from the Zoo Crew Designer Series Paper and added my sentiment and some In Color Opal Rounds.

I love the card on page 27 that I am CASEing this week.  It's one that has so many die cut elements but it really caught my eye straight away when going through the pages.

I have pretty much cased it as it is featured in the Annual Catalogue, I have used the Exposed Brick 3D Textured Embossing Folder as my background with Daffodil Delight applied with the Blending Brush instead of the mask.  

I may have used the Lemon Lime Twist as the lighter green on the leaves otherwise the colours are the same.


I love the 3 purple tones - Fresh Freesia, Highland Heather and Gorgeous Grape.  I did also use my sponge dauber in Highland Heather on the centre of the pansy over the top of the Fresh Freesia which gives it further depth of colour.

I have chosen to case the box on page 67.  I do not have the Timeless Arrangements Bundle but I was inspired by the centre sentiment and the flowers and foliage that surround it.

I have used the new Bubble Bath cardstock which I stamped some splashes of colour in Moody Mauve and then layered onto my base of Moody Mauve cardstock with a strip of cardstock in the centre which I used the Deckled Rectangles dies to create a torn edge look instead of the ribbon.  

The leaves and flower are stamped using a variety of colours on Basic White cardstock and a few on Old Olive cardstock to give another layer of depth and with the punch it was so easy to cut them all out quickly.  

I stamped the sentiment on Basic White and then layering onto Moody Mauve using the retired Beautiful Shades dies.  I put this sentiment in the centre on dimensionals and then poked all the leaves and flowers under the sentiment and then added some Wild Wheat from the Christmas Pinecone Dies.  Finally I added 3 of the Moody Mauve In Colour Dots on the edges of the foliage.
